WHAT ARE THE CAUSES OF KNEE PAIN AND INJURY?
Knee pain is the second biggest cause of musculoskeletal pain and disability, due to its huge complexity. It can range from short bursts of localised discomfort through to extremely significant amounts of pain. Most cases of knee pain and injury are triggered by a combination of, postural mis-alignment, overuse, repetitive strain, injury (or trauma), and inflammation to the structures of the knee. Severity varies, but below are some examples of common causes of knee pain and injury.

ACUTE VS CHRONIC KNEE PAIN
-
ACUTE PAIN is often due to direct trauma or injuries such as ligament tears, or sprains.
-
CHRONIC PAIN may be a results from progressive wear and tear, repetitive strain, or degenerative conditions like osteoarthritis.
It is extremely important to be aware of more sinister causes of knee pain, like inflammatory arthritis (rheumatoid arthritis, reactive arthritis, psoriatic arthritis...). Other important symptoms to be aware of are prolonged morning joint stiffness, increased swelling, multiple joint pain/swelling, fever, altered sensation or tingling down the leg, ongoing cramps in the legs, fatigue, weight loss and night pain.

Gradual progressive cartilage degeneration causing pain, stiffness, swelling and reduced functional mobility.
Pain at the front and behind the knee cap, often due to imbalances, sports and overuse.

Inflammation of the patellar tendon often due to sports, or overuse.
Ligaments are strong connective tissues that stabilise joints. Sprains or tears, such as ACL, MCL, LCL, or PCL injuries are common following trauma, twisting movements, or sports-related activities.
The meniscus is a piece of cartilage that cushions the knee. Damage or tearing often results from sudden twists or degeneration over time, causing joint pain and instability.
This condition occurs when the bursa (small fluid-filled sacs that reduce friction) becomes inflamed. It commonly affects the knees, shoulders, hips, or elbows.

If patients do not respond adequately to conservative treatment or the problem is getting worse, then consideration for injection therapy may be discussed. If patients are showing signs of advanced injury or disease, then we may discuss the option for an MRI scanning to get diagnostic clarity of what it is that may be causing the issue. Generally speaking, based from a sound justifiable working diagnosis, not all vases may need imaging prior to treatment.
If a cause of your knee pain is suspected to be of an inflammatory, autoimmune or rheumatological origin, then you will be asked to provide a blood test and lab panel to check for raised inflammatory markers - ESR, CRP and TNFa, and maybe immunological makers.
